metlab画柱状图,y的数据在table中
时间: 2024-02-15 16:04:00 浏览: 24
好的,你可以按照以下步骤使用MATLAB画出柱状图:
1.首先,你需要将数据从表格中读取出来,可以使用MATLAB中的readtable函数,比如:
```
T = readtable('data.xlsx');
y = T.y;
```
其中,data.xlsx是保存数据的Excel文件名,y是你需要绘制柱状图的数据。
2.然后,你可以使用MATLAB中的bar函数绘制柱状图,比如:
```
bar(y);
```
这样就会在图形窗口中绘制出柱状图了。
3.如果你需要对柱状图进行更多的自定义设置,比如添加横轴标签、纵轴标签、标题等等,可以使用MATLAB中的xlabel、ylabel、title函数,比如:
```
xlabel('X Label');
ylabel('Y Label');
title('Bar Chart');
```
这样就可以添加标签和标题了。
希望这个回答能够帮助到你!
相关问题
matlab中excel表画柱状图
在Matlab中,可以使用`readtable`函数将Excel表格读入Matlab中,然后使用`bar`函数来绘制柱状图。以下是一个简单的例子:
```matlab
% 读取Excel表格数据
data = readtable('data.xlsx');
% 绘制柱状图
bar(data.X, data.Y);
% 添加标题和标签
title('柱状图');
xlabel('X轴');
ylabel('Y轴');
```
在上面的代码中,`data.xlsx`是Excel表格的文件名,`data.X`和`data.Y`分别是Excel表格中的两列数据。`bar`函数用于绘制柱状图。你可以通过调整`bar`函数的参数来改变柱状图的样式,例如颜色、线条宽度等。
最后,使用`title`、`xlabel`和`ylabel`函数来添加图表的标题和标签。执行上面的代码,将得到一个简单的柱状图。
matlab如何导入excel数据制作柱状图
为您解答:
首先,您需要将Excel数据导入到MATLAB中,可以使用readmatrix函数读取Excel中的数值数据,readtable函数读取包含表头和行索引的Excel表格数据。
例如,使用readmatrix函数导入Excel文件中名为“Sheet1”的数据:
data = readmatrix('filename.xlsx','Sheet','Sheet1');
接下来,使用bar函数制作柱状图,即可显示数据:
bar(data);
如果需要显示X轴、Y轴标签,可使用xlabel、ylabel函数添加标签,例如:
xlabel('X轴标签');
ylabel('Y轴标签');
希望能帮到您!